Broken SATA cable A1470 Time Capsule

Hello Everybody,

I was just succeeding in replacing the broken fan when...the HDD went sideways in reinserting it and broke the sata connector on the disk side.


I would like to know:

1) If it is possible -safely enough- to unplug the SATA connector from the mainboard side; some say no, but further expert advice is always welcome;

2) If it is still possible to find and buy a working sata cable for the Time Capsule A1470, don’t mind if it’s second hand.

You can disconnect the SATA from the board. There is a protective lock which you can only slide off once outside the case.

I will take a few pics shortly to show you.

NOTE.. we warn people all the time that changing fans can result in broken SATA cables.


Getting a replacement is near impossible. Nobody much offers them so what you want is a dead or dying or very cheap second hand gen5 TC from second hand market, eBay etc.

IMHO a 5 year old TC is due retirement so it might be easier to take the opportunity to move on.
